Is it a Code or Cipher?
Another possibility is that lmzhiwbf is a coded message, a cipher of sorts. People have been using ciphers for centuries to keep their messages secret, and there are countless ways to encode information. Some ciphers are simple, like a basic letter substitution where each letter is replaced by another (think A becomes B, B becomes C, and so on). Others are much more complex, involving mathematical algorithms or keyword-based substitutions. If it's a cipher, cracking it could require some detective work. We might try common cipher techniques like frequency analysis, looking for patterns in the letters, or even trying known cipher methods like Caesar ciphers or Vigenère ciphers. The complexity of the cipher will determine how difficult it is to crack. Letter Frequency Analysis
If we suspect lmzhiwbf might be a cipher, letter frequency analysis can be a useful technique. This involves looking at how often each letter appears in the string and comparing it to the typical frequency of letters in the English language. For example, in English, the letter "E" is the most common, followed by "T," "A," and "O." If we see a letter in lmzhiwbf that appears much more frequently than others, it might be a substitute for one of these common letters.
